Chiang Mai offers a blend of cultural, natural, and culinary experiences that can appeal to various interests. One of the highlights is exploring the historic temples, such as Wat Phra That Doi Suthep, which provides stunning views of the city and insight into local spirituality. The Old City is home to several ancient structures, allowing visitors to appreciate the rich history and architecture of the area.
For those interested in local craftsmanship, the night markets are worth visiting. The Chiang Mai Night Bazaar and the Sunday Walking Street market provide opportunities to purchase handmade goods, sample street food, and experience the vibrant atmosphere of the city. Additionally, attending a cooking class can be an engaging way to learn about Thai cuisine, with many classes emphasizing the use of local ingredients and traditional methods.
Nature enthusiasts may find enjoyment in the surrounding mountains and national parks. Activities such as trekking, visiting waterfalls, and exploring the diverse flora and fauna are popular. Nearby, the Elephant Nature Park offers an ethical way to interact with elephants, emphasizing conservation and rehabilitation.
Cultural immersion can also be experienced through participation in local festivals, such as Yi Peng and Songkran, which showcase traditional practices and community spirit. Engaging with local communities, perhaps through volunteer opportunities, can provide deeper insights into the lifestyle and customs of the region.
Lastly, taking time to relax in one of the many spas that offer traditional Thai massages can be a restorative experience after a day of exploration. Chiang Mai's combination of history, nature, and culture makes it a well-rounded destination for various travelers.
